Description

As part of the latest phase of the Mallard Creek Solids Improvements Project, CLT Water completed a condition assessment and an optimization and reliability study. Areas needing improvement were identified and documented in a PER. Final designs were completed, and the construction of this project will be bid in the summer of 2026.

Areas needing improvement were identified and documented in a PER. Final designs were completed, and the construction of this project will be bid in the summer of 2026. Construction will include components of solids treatment including: spiral heat exchangers, recirculation pumps, sludge transfer pumps, feed pumps, hot water feed pumps, gas treatment, new waste biogas flare , a new e-house, new boiler building and boilers, as well as digester building improvements (e.g. trench drains, doors, guardrails, handrails, hoist, concrete repairs, HVAC, water piping, vents) Full rehabilitation of the existing drying beds is also included.
